考试首页 | 考试用书 | 培训课程 | 模拟考场 | 考试论坛  
全国  |             |          |          |          |          |         
  当前位置:计算机等级 > 二级考试 > Visual Basic > VB模拟试题 > 文章内容
  

全国计算机等级考试VB语言考试试题答案(20)

中华IT学院   【 】  [ 2016年3月16日 ]

一个工程中包含两个名称分别为Form、Form的窗体,一个名称为MdFunc的标准模块。假定在Form、Form和MdFunc中分别建立了自定义过程,其定义格式为:
      Form中定义的过程:

Private Sub frmFunction()

……

End Sub
Form中定义的过程:

Private Sub frmFunction()

……

End Sub
mdlFunc中定义的过程:

Public Sub mdFunction()

……

End Sub
在调用上述过程的程序中,如果不指明窗体或模块的名称,则以下叙述中正确的是______。

A)上述三个过程都可以在工程中的任何窗体或模块中被调用

B)frmFunction和mdlFunction过程能够在工程中各个窗体或模块中被调用

C)上述三个过程都只能在各自被定义的模块中调用

D)只有MdFunction过程能够被工程中各个窗体或模块调用

以下叙述中错误的是______。

A)一个工程中可以包含多个窗体文件

B)在一个窗体文件中用Public定义的通用过程不能被其他窗体调用

C)窗体和标准模块需要分别保存为不同类型的磁盘文件

D)用Dim定义的窗体层变量只能在该窗体中使用

下面的过程定义语句中合法的是______。

A)Sub Procl(ByVal n()) B)Sub Procl(n) As Integer  C)Function Procl(Procl) D)Function Procl(ByVal n)

. 在过程中定义的变量,若希望在离开该过程后,还能保存过程中局部变量的值,则使用______关键字在过程中定义局部变量。

A)Dim  B)Private  C)Public  D)Static

. 以下正确的描述是:在Visual Basic应用程序中______。

A)过程的定义可以嵌套,但过程的调用不能嵌套。

B)过程的定义不可以嵌套,但过程的调用可以嵌套。

C)过程的定义和过程的调用均可以嵌套。

D)过程的定义和过程的调用均不能嵌套。

. 有子过程语句说明:Sub fSum(sum%,ByVal m%,ByVal n%),且在事件过程中有如下变量说明:Dim a%,b%,c!则下列调用语句中正确的是______。

A)fsum a,a,b  B)fsum ,,  C)fsum a+b,a,b  D)Call fsum (c,a,B)

. 在过程调用中,参数的传递可以分为______和按地址传递两种方式。

A)按值传递 B)按地址传递 C)按参数传递 D)按位置传递

. 要想在过程调用后返回两个结果,下面的过程定义语句合法的是______。

A)Sub Procl(ByVal n,ByVal m) B)Sub Procl(n,ByVal m)  C)Sub Procl(n,m) D)Sub Procl(ByVal n,m)

BDACBACABA

分享到:
本文纠错】【告诉好友】【打印此文】【返回顶部
将考试网添加到收藏夹 | 每次上网自动访问考试网 | 复制本页地址,传给QQ/MSN上的好友 | 申请链接 | 意见留言 TOP
关于本站  网站声明  广告服务  联系方式  站内导航  考试论坛
Copyright © 2006-2017 中华考试网(Examw.com) All Rights Reserved  营业执照